Ordinals
beta
Sat 642180151809751
decimal
128436.151809751
degree
0°128436′1428″151809751‴
percentile
30.580007262673785%
name
jhlysvswlqg
cycle
0
epoch
0
period
63
block
128436
offset
151809751
timestamp
2011-06-03 22:38:41 UTC
rarity
common
prev
next